What Does a Renters Insurance Agent in Pearl City Cost?

Typical renters insurance in Hawaii costs between 15 and 30 dollars per month for 15,000 to 30,000 dollars in personal property coverage. Pearl City rates may be slightly higher due to proximity to the coast and flood risk. Actual cost depends on your coverage limits, deductible, credit score, and claims history. Is renters insurance required by law in Hawaii?
No, Hawaii state law does not require renters insurance. However, many landlords in Pearl City include a lease clause that requires tenants to carry a policy. An agent can help you meet that requirement.
What does a renters insurance agent in Pearl City do?
An agent helps you compare policies from different insurers. They explain coverage limits, deductibles, and optional add-ons for Hawaii specific perils like tsunami or lava flow. They also assist with filing claims after a loss.
